Riff with Dr Biff: Is it me or is it Perimenopause?

Menopause.


Something that happens in your 50s and 60s, right?


Not exactly. While menopause itself marks the official end of our periods, the lead-up—perimenopause— starts much earlier in our 40s, and sometimes even in our 30s. It’s not that menopause is happening younger; we’re just becoming more aware of the changes our bodies go through in the years before it.


So if you’re dealing with irregular periods, sudden bursts of rage at your perfectly innocent partner, insomnia, or mood swings that make no sense—perimenopause could be the culprit. Or, of course, it might just mean you are a full-timer in dire need of a holiday.


In this second episode, Dr. Biff joins us again to talk about how to recognise perimenopause, the myths and misconceptions surrounding it, the impact it can have on women, and—most importantly—what we can actually do about it. And good news: managing it might be simpler than you think.

Comparison: The Thief of Joy
<p>How many times a day do you find yourself comparing your cooking skills, parenting, careers, marriage, wrinkles, handbags and everything else in between with others? If you don't, well, you're only 10% of the female population. </p><p>Over 90% of women say they compare themselves, their success (or lack of it) with others. Women are also more likely to compare what they don't have versus what they do have - leading to a feeling of inadequacy, discrepancy or failure. </p><p>This is despite the fact that we all know social media is a series of highlight reels, and we never truly know what is going on behind closed doors. So, we're advocating for more transparency and authenticity in how we portray our lives, more empathy over envy, and using people's success as both reason for celebration (after all, one woman's success is a gain for all women!) and for inspiration to push ourselves forward. </p><br /><hr><p style='color:grey; font-size:0.75em;'> Hosted on Acast.
